What did Georgia do in 1956 to protest school integration?
Change the state flag
What did the state of Georgia incorporate into the Georgia flag as a form of protest in 1956?
The Confederate Battle Flag
What was Martin Luther King's occupation/job?
Pastor
What did Brown vs. Board of Education decide?
Segregation was unconstitutional
What Supreme Court case did Brown v. Board of Education overturn?
Plessy v. Ferguson
This event was considered a turning point for the Civil Rights Movement, with 250,000 in attendance?
March on Washington
What speech did Martin Luther King, Jr. give at the March on Washington?
"I Have a Dream"
Who was the last openly segregationist governor in GA, whose restaurant was shut down?
Lester Maddox
How did schools change as a result of Brown v. Board of Education?
Integration
Martin Luther King, Jr. was the first president of this organization that helped organize civil rights protests?
SCLC (Southern Christian Leadership Conference)
What student group conducted sit-ins and "freedom rides" throughout the south to protest segregation?
SNCC (Student Nonviolent Coordinating Committee)
Which president signed the Civil Rights Act of 1964?
Lyndon B. Johnson
What was Martin Luther King, Jr.'s four pronged approach to gaining civil rights?
Nonviolent protest, Legal Action, Ballots, Economic Boycotts
Why did Georgia change its flag in 1956 to include the Confederate Battle Flag?
To protest Brown v. Board of Education
What was the goal of the Sibley Commission?
To find out how Georgians felt about segregation
What was the goal of the Albany Movement?
To end all types of segregation in Albany, GA
The Civil Rights Act of 1964 stated that _________________.
Public places could not be segregated
What was the purpose of the March on Washington?
To gain equal access to jobs and freedom for all
What did the Sibley Commission recommend?
School boards should be allowed to decide if they want to integrate
Before he was governor, how did Lester Maddox show his opposition to the 1964 Civil Rights Act?
Refused to serve African Americans at his restaurant
Which civil rights leader was the keynote speaker at the March on Washington, wrote a series of graphic novels called "March", and was a member of the U.S. House of Representatives?
John Lewis
Define Jim Crow Laws
Laws in the South that required separation between races
The NAACP argued that Linda Brown and other students in segregated schools did not receive the right to equal protection of the laws guaranteed by which amendment
14th Amendment
The term "Bloody Sunday" was used to describe the events of...
The Selma to Montgomery Freedom March
Sit-ins involved
college students sitting at white lunch counters enduring threats and violence, a form of non-violent protest
What is it called when people stop using a service in order to create change?
A boycott
